概要

世界の幹細胞製造の市場規模は、2022年に123億米ドルに達しました。今後、IMARCグループは、2023年から2028年の間に8.1%の成長率(CAGR)を示し、2028年までに199億米ドルに達すると予測しています。

幹細胞は、動物や植物の組織や臓器を構成する未分化または部分的に分化した細胞です。幹細胞は一般的に、血液、骨髄、臍帯、胚、胎盤から供給されます。幹細胞は、体内および実験室の条件が整えば、分裂して赤血球、血小板、白血球などの細胞を形成し、特殊な機能を発揮することができます。幹細胞は、ヒトの疾患モデル、創薬、治療不可能な疾患に対する細胞治療の開発、遺伝子治療、組織工学などに広く利用されています。幹細胞は、生存能力を維持し、遺伝子の変化を最小限に抑えるために冷凍保存され、その結果、損傷した臓器や組織の代替やさまざまな疾患の治療に使用されます。

幹細胞製造の市場動向

  • 世界市場は主に、幹細胞の治療効力に関する認知度の上昇により、幹細胞研究に対するベンチャーキャピタル(VC)の投資が増加していることに牽引されています。これとは別に、効果的な疾病管理、個別化医療、ゲノム検査などの用途で製品が広く利用されていることも、市場の成長に好影響を与えています。さらに、3次元(3D)プリンティングやマイクロ流体技術を取り入れ、複数の生産工程を1つの装置に統合することで生産時間を短縮し、コストを削減していることも、市場成長に弾みをつけています。さらに、腫瘍、白血病、リンパ腫の治療のための造血幹細胞(HSC)および間葉系幹細胞(MSC)ベースの薬剤を製造するための製薬業界での製品利用の増加が、別の成長促進要因として作用しています。さらに、機能改善や病気の進行を助ける新薬を生み出すための研究用途での製品用途が増加していることも、市場を大きく後押ししています。このほか、組織や臓器の置換治療における技術の利用拡大、医療インフラの大幅な改善、公衆衛生を促進するさまざまな政府施策の実施などが、市場を牽引すると予想されます。

The global stem cell manufacturing market size reached US$ 12.3 Billion in 2022. Looking forward, IMARC Group expects the market to reach US$ 19.9 Billion by 2028, exhibiting a growth rate (CAGR) of 8.1% during 2023-2028.

Stem cells are undifferentiated or partially differentiated cells that make up the tissues and organs of animals and plants. They are commonly sourced from blood, bone marrow, umbilical cord, embryo, and placenta. Under the right body and laboratory conditions, stem cells can divide to form more cells, such as red blood cells (RBCs), platelets, and white blood cells, which generate specialized functions. They are widely used for human disease modeling, drug discovery, development of cell therapies for untreatable diseases, gene therapy, and tissue engineering. Stem cells are cryopreserved to maintain their viability and minimize genetic change and are consequently used later to replace damaged organs and tissues and treat various diseases.

Stem Cell Manufacturing Market Trends:

  • The global market is primarily driven by the increasing venture capital (VC) investments in stem cell research due to the rising awareness about the therapeutic potency of stem cells. Apart from this, the widespread product utilization in effective disease management, personalized medicine, and genome testing applications are favoring the market growth. Additionally, the incorporation of three-dimensional (3D) printing and microfluidic technologies to reduce production time and lower cost by integrating multiple production steps into one device is providing an impetus to the market growth. Furthermore, the increasing product utilization in the pharmaceutical industry for manufacturing hematopoietic stem cells (HSC)- and mesenchymal stem cells (MSC)-based drugs for treating tumors, leukemia, and lymphoma is acting as another growth-inducing factor. Moreover, the increasing product application in research applications to produce new drugs that assist in improving functions and altering the progress of diseases is providing a considerable boost to the market. Other factors, including the increasing usage of the technique in tissue and organ replacement therapies, significant improvements in medical infrastructure, and the implementation of various government initiatives promoting public health, are anticipated to drive the market.
